Ann Holaday, an ayurvedic professional whose passion is to tell the world about the amazing powers of ayurveda and yoga. She was born, brought up and educated in Britain and now lives in Washington State. She has three grownup children and two grandsons. Her career was in radiation therapy where she was an educator, manager and practitioner. She is the author of “The Mountain Never Cries,” and a teacher of English as a Second Language. She has been married twice, widowed twice and since the death of her second husband has traveled the world. She has lived in Puerto Rico, New Zealand, India, Britain and US. Ayurveda found her in India when she was captured by the timeless knowledge of life. She studied under Dr David Frawley and Dr Vasant Lad in the US, and JIVA Institute and Ayurveda College in India. She is a professional member of NAMA and AAPNA. She is founder of According to Ayurveda and Yoga, an international association for the furtherance of ayurveda and yoga through education.
